In a groundbreaking move at the intersection of AI and crypto, MoonPay has unveiled a new feature that allows users of AI chatbots like ChatGPT and Claude to authorize cryptocurrency transactions directly through its Vault service. The integration, reported by TradingView, marks a significant step toward making AI assistants active participants in the digital asset economy, potentially reshaping how users interact with both AI and blockchain technology.
Bridging AI and Blockchain: The MoonPay Vault Integration
MoonPay's Vault is a secure storage solution designed to protect users' digital assets. With this latest update, Vault users can now connect their accounts to AI assistants powered by OpenAI's ChatGPT or Anthropic's Claude, enabling these AI models to initiate and authorize transactions on behalf of the user. This development essentially turns AI chatbots into crypto-savvy companions that can handle payments, transfers, or other blockchain operations when given permission.
The integration works by allowing users to grant specific authorization to an AI assistant, which can then interact with the MoonPay Vault API to execute transactions. While the exact technical details remain under wraps, the move signals a clear push toward more autonomous AI agents in the financial sector, a trend that has been gaining momentum across the tech industry.
Why This Matters for Crypto Adoption
This development is more than just a novel feature; it could be a catalyst for broader crypto adoption. By enabling AI chatbots to handle transactions, MoonPay is lowering the barrier to entry for users who may find traditional crypto interfaces intimidating. Instead of navigating complex wallets and gas fees, users could simply ask their AI assistant to make a payment or purchase a token, making the process as simple as sending a text message.
Moreover, this integration opens up new possibilities for automated trading, recurring payments, and even AI-driven portfolio management. For instance, a user could instruct ChatGPT to buy a certain amount of Bitcoin when the price drops to a specific level, and the AI would execute that order via MoonPay Vault. This level of automation could attract a new wave of users interested in leveraging AI for smarter financial decisions.
Security and Trust Considerations
Of course, with increased automation comes heightened concerns about security. Granting an AI assistant the ability to authorize transactions requires robust safeguards to prevent unauthorized access or malicious use. MoonPay has emphasized that the Vault employs advanced encryption and multi-factor authentication, and users retain full control over the permissions they grant to AI assistants. The company is likely to face scrutiny from regulators and security experts, but early reactions suggest optimism about the potential benefits.
